LINUX.ORG.RU

Сообщения McMCC

 

Обнаружен критический баг в libunrar+clamav!

Группа Безопасность

Всем, кто использует libunrar совместно с Clamav, для проверки архивов RAR v.3, недавно был обнаружен критический баг, который приводил работу clamd/clamdscan/clamscan к Segmentation fault на запаролленных RAR архивах. Обнаружил этот баг Сергей Остащенко, который любезно предоставил архивный файл, на котором происходит падение Clamav'а.

Мною выпущена "заплатка" для libunrar-3.5.x: http://mcmcc.bat.ru/clamav/ftello_unr...

Падение Clamav можно проверить на этом файле:http://mcmcc.bat.ru/clamav/hz.rar

McMCC
()

Micro Watchdog timer на микроконтроллере PIC16F630 для PC.

Группа Hardware and Drivers

Многие, наверное, сталкивались с ситуацией, когда необходима надежная и бесперебойная работа сервера в режиме 24/7, даже покупая дорогое проверенное железо, нет ни какой гарантии, что оно не "повиснет" в неподходящий момент, причиной этого может стать сыроватость ядра ОС или драйвера какой-нибудь железки, а то и вовсе из-за его брака. Главная проблема в том, что в этот неприятный момент может ни кого не оказаться по близости с этим сервером, что бы нажать на кнопку "RESET", и с этого момента, оценивая важность этого сервера, у вас начинаются проблемы, если повисший сервер вовремя не начнет свою работу....
В статье рассказывается как собрать недорогой Watchdog на микроконтроллере
PIC16F630, что бы затем его можно было использовать на серверах под
управлением Linux/FreeBSD/Windows NT/2K/XP...

>>> Подробности

McMCC
()

Clamav и проверка архивов 7-Zip.

Группа Безопасность

В статье рассказывается о том, как прикрутить проверку архивов созданных
архиватором 7-Zip, который в последнее становится все более популярным,
а по степени сжатия не уступает, а то и превосходит RAR, к последней
версии ClamAV.

>>> Подробности

McMCC
()

Новая версия плагина поддержки формата WMA V1/V2 для XMMS и BMP.

Группа Open Source

Выложил новую версию плагина XMMS-WMA(+BEEPMP-WMA) v.1.0.5.
Изменения:
- Сделаны исправления для сборки с помощью gcc4.
- Добавлена возможность сборки плагина для плеера BMP.
- Устранен баг с пробелами при использовании gnome-vfs в BMP.
ВНИМАНИЕ: BEEPMP-WMA конфликтует с BMP-WMA. Удалите BMP-WMA
или не используйте BEEPMP-WMA.
RPM BEEPMP-WMA:
http://mcmcc.bat.ru/xmms-wma/beepmp-w...
http://mcmcc.bat.ru/xmms-wma/beepmp-w...
RPM XMMS-WMA:
http://mcmcc.bat.ru/xmms-wma/xmms-wma...
http://mcmcc.bat.ru/xmms-wma/xmms-wma...
Общие TARBZ2 исходники:
http://mcmcc.bat.ru/xmms-wma/xmms-wma...

>>> Подробности

McMCC
()

SERP - Serial EEPROM Programmer for 24CXX/93CXX для Linux и Windows 2000/XP.

Группа Hardware and Drivers

Программатор SERP(СЕРП) предназначен для программирования микросхем
памяти серий 24CXX и 93CXX, т.е. с шинами i2c и microwire. Целью создания
этого программатора послужила периодическая необходимость в
программировании только этих типов микросхем памяти, которые
встречаются, чуть ли не во всех бытовых радиоустройствах, автомобильной
электронике, в сетевом оборудовании и т.д. Программатор был разработан
таким образом, что бы его мог собрать любой начинающий радиолюбитель,
т.к. он практически не содержит радиодеталей, и относится к разряду "low
cost" устройств "наколенного" типа. Подключается такой программатор к
параллельному порту компьютера. К тому же, его можно собрать не
полностью, а под конкретную серию микросхем памяти, что еще более
упрощает его сборку.

>>> Подробности

McMCC
()

Clamav-0.84 и проверка RAR архивов версии 3.

Группа Безопасность

Всем, кто просил проверку архивов созданных RAR 3.x для clamav-0.84, выложил новые rpm пакеты:
RPMS:
http://mcmcc.bat.ru/clamav/clamav-0.8...
http://mcmcc.bat.ru/clamav/clamav-dev...
необязательный:
http://mcmcc.bat.ru/clamav/clamav-mil...
SRPMS:
http://mcmcc.bat.ru/clamav/clamav-0.8...
Для тех, кто ставит впервые, нужно предварительно установить libunrar:
RPMS:
http://mcmcc.bat.ru/clamav/libunrar3-...
SRPMS:
http://mcmcc.bat.ru/clamav/libunrar3-...
Тем, кому не нужны пакеты, отдельный патч для clamav-0.84:
http://mcmcc.bat.ru/clamav/clamav-0.8...
и для unrar-3.4.3:
http://mcmcc.bat.ru/clamav/unrar-3.4....

P.S. Тем, кто использует FreeBSD, libunrar нужно собирать через
gmake, в новом патче для clamav включен инклюд stdlib.h, без
которого при сборке на FreeBSD возникала ошибка:
/usr/include/libunrar3/dll.hpp:...... syntax error before `wchar_t'
Теперь этих проблем не должно быть....

Спасибо всем тем, кто принимал участие в тестировании и багрепортах...

>>> На главную страницу

McMCC
()

VLAN «разветвитель» своими руками.

Группа Hardware and Drivers

Многие наверное часто сталкиваются с проблемой не хватки второго сетевого
интерфейса или даже нескольких, но хуже всего, когда нет возможности
установить дополнительные сетевые карты в сервер или какой либо роутер,
тогда приходиться мириться и подымать на таких устройствах, если это
возможно, субинтерфейсы, однако такое решение многих может не устроить,
т.к. возникает необходимость в полной изоляции сетей между собой, т.е.
физическое разделение на сегменты, в этом случае поможет только
использование 802.1Q VLAN....

В статье говорится, как из дешевого 13-ти баксового свича сделать VLAN
"разветвитель" своими руками, а так же, как с ним потом работать в Linux'е...

>>> Подробности

McMCC
()

USB Mass Storage драйвер для USB-IDE контроллера USS725(ISD-11x) под ядра 2.6.9 и выше...

Группа Hardware and Drivers

В свое время, примерно 2-а года назад, этот драйвер был выпущен для ядер
ветки 2.4.хх:
http://www.linux.org.ru/view-message....
Основной автор драйвера, Nicolas Planel из Мандрейксофта, сделал порт
для ядра 2.6.0, однако этот драйвер работал до версии ядра 2.6.5, далее
был изменен API USB и он перестал работать и поддерживаться, посчитали
его поддержку не актуальной. Этот драйвер входил в состав дистрибутивов
Mandrake до 10-ой версии включительно, затем его поддержку отключили...
Мною было решено восстановить его работу с последними ядрами 2.6.9 и 2.6.10,
т.к. устройств с этим контроллером еще очень много живет и работает, добавил
в него все свои последние исправления, которых небыло в Mandrake, в
частности для ZIV1 и выложил по ссылке:
http://mcmcc.bat.ru/mypatches/linux-2...

P.S. Данный драйвер работает со всеми последними ядрами от Fedora Project...

>>> Подробности

McMCC
()

Найден критический баг в связке Clamav и проверка RAR архивов версии 3.

Группа Безопасность

Найден критический баг в сканировании exe файлов после установки патча
clamav-libunrar3.patch на Clamav, он заключается в том, что после
сканирования саморасспаковывающихся exe архивов созданных RAR 2/3.x
не возвращается позиция на начало файла в дескрипторе, соответсвенно
следущая проверка не выполняется, так как ей достается конец, что в
свою очередь обеспечивает свободное прохождение вирусов. Всем, кто
использует данную связку советую наложить fix на ранние патчи или взять
новые версии патча, архивов или rpm пакетов приведенных в статье
"Clamav и проверка RAR архивов версии 3".
Выражаю большую благодарность Ruwa(Russu Valery) за найденный баг!

Fix на ранние патчи:
http://mcmcc.bat.ru/clamav/clamav-exe...
Новый патч:
http://mcmcc.bat.ru/clamav/clamav-lib...
TAR_BZ:
http://mcmcc.bat.ru/clamav/clamav-0.8...
RPMS:
http://mcmcc.bat.ru/clamav/clamav-0.8...
http://mcmcc.bat.ru/clamav/clamav-dev...
SRPM:
http://mcmcc.bat.ru/clamav/clamav-0.8...

P.S. Все старые патчи, архивы и rpm пакеты удалены с сайта...

>>> Подробности

McMCC
()

Clamav и проверка RAR архивов версии 3.

Группа Документация

В данной статье рассказывается о том, как прикрутить проверку RAR архивов, созданных RAR'ом 3-ей версии...

>>> Подробности

McMCC
()

WMA2WAV - конвертор формата WMA в WAV или другие...

Группа Open Source

Данный конвертор основан на библиотеке ffmpeg и позволяет перегонять
формат WMA в любой существующий и доступный. По началу программа
задумывалась как обычный конвертор из WMA в WAV, но потом пришла
идея, что можно добавить запуск bash/perl/etc скриптов, передавая им
переменные из программы, затем из полученного WAV файла сразу
конвертить через скрипты во что угодно, так же есть возможность
указывать директории, при этом программа будет брать только WMA файлы
из указанной директории, включая поддиректории, и сохранять в
указанную директорию с поддиректориями аналогично входящей
директории, это было сделано для того, что бы облегчить преобразования с
CD дисков, сетевых шар и т.д..

Скачать последнюю версию:
исходники:
http://mcmcc.bat.ru/xmms-wma/wma2wav/...
RPM:
http://mcmcc.bat.ru/xmms-wma/wma2wav/...
RPMS:
http://mcmcc.bat.ru/xmms-wma/wma2wav/...

>>> Подробности

McMCC
()

Плагин XMMS-WMA v.1.0.0 - первая стабильная версия.

Группа Open Source

Это первая стабильная версия плагина поддержки формата WMA для
плеера XMMS, в ней устранены практически все ошибки связанные
с работой плагина. Скачать можно отсюда:
Исходники tar:
http://mcmcc.bat.ru/xmms-wma/xmms-wma...
RPMS:
http://mcmcc.bat.ru/xmms-wma/xmms-wma...
SRPMS:
http://mcmcc.bat.ru/xmms-wma/xmms-wma...

>>> Подробности

McMCC
()

Новые плагины для Alsaplayer с поддержкой WMA и aRts

Группа Open Source

2а новых плагина для неплохого, с моей точки зрения, аудиоплеера
Alsaplayer http://www.alsaplayer.org, данный плеер хоть и уступает по
возможностям и популярности XMMS, но имеет не плохую функциональность и поддерживает большое кол-во форматов для воспризведения, теперь еще добавилась поддержка воспроизведения
формата WMA и проигрывание через звуковой сервер от KDE - aRts....

Взять WMA плагин можно здесь:
http://mcmcc.bat.ru/xmms-wma/alsaplay...
RPMS:
http://mcmcc.bat.ru/xmms-wma/alsaplay...
RPM:
http://mcmcc.bat.ru/xmms-wma/alsaplay...

aRts плагин:
http://mcmcc.bat.ru/xmms-wma/alsaplay...
RPMS:
http://mcmcc.bat.ru/xmms-wma/alsaplay...
RPM:
http://mcmcc.bat.ru/xmms-wma/alsaplay...

>>> Подробности

McMCC
()

Плагин XMMS-WMA v.0.1.2

Группа Open Source

Новая версия плагина для воспроизведения файлов WMA формата под
XMMS. Основные изменения: Удалось засинхронизировать работу плагина
для работы визуальных плагинов, улучшена работа с ALSA output плагином,
теперь нет большой нагрузки на CPU. Проблемы: Не работает пауза при
работе с ALSA output плагином, а так же с некоторыми драйверами ALSA
приходится отключать опцию mmap в плагине ALSA. Как побороть эти
2-е проблемы, мне пока неизвестно, если кто сможет помочь, приму с
благодарностью....

>>> Скачать исходники и готовые rmp'ки

McMCC
()

Плагин XMMS-WMA v.0.1

Группа Open Source

Теперь есть возможность воспроизводить файлы формата WMA
общеизвестным плеером XMMS. Это полностью нативный плагин
без привязок к mplayer'у или xine, он основан на коде ffmpeg,
который сильно урезан и переработан, в нем оставлена только часть для
работы с wma и добавлена работа с русскими тэгами, более подробно
о том, что сделано и не сделано описано в файле readme.rus, который
находится в исходниках плагина.

>>> Скачать исходники и готовые rmp'ки

McMCC
()

Вышла новая версия Clam AntiVirus 0.66

Группа Open Source

На сегодня это наверное единственный сканер для вирусов в открытых
исходниках и под лицензией GPL, который ловит вирусы не хуже своих
коммерческих собратьев, а для почтовых систем подходит просто идеально...
Посравнению с предыдущей версией изменений много, вот главные
из них:
- Убран баг способствующий remote DOS exploit, если у вас версия 0.65,
то обязательно обновитесь
- Добавлен виндовый клиент-сканер, который позволяет сканировать
Windows систему на вирусы через clamd сервер установленного на
юникс серверах по сети
- Много изменений в milter модуле clamav-milter для sendmail, добавлен
карантин, подпись в теле сообщения письма после проверки, убраны
memory leakи и т.д.
- В libclamav улучшены механизмы сканирования для почтовых сообщений
и файлов созданных в MS Office, теперь макрос-вирусы ловятся гораздо
лучше...
Про более детальные изменения читайте в ChangeLog из архива, который
вы можете взять по ссылке:
http://clamav.catt.com/stable/clamav-...

>>> Подробности

McMCC
()

Переход от RedHat на Fedora Core.

Группа Red Hat

Данная статья посвящена недавно вышедшему дистрибутиву Fedora Core.
В статье рассматриваются некоторые рекомендации и исправления
части найденых проблем, думаю, что эта статья будет многим интересна,
так как она затрагивает некоторую часть основных моментов.

>>> Подробности

McMCC
()

Вышла новая версия Win4Lin v.5.1 (Fedora edition)

Группа Проприетарное ПО

В связи с выходом нового дистрибутива Fedora Core 1, компания Netraverse
выпустила новые версии своих продуктов Win4Lin и WTS(Win4Lin Terminal Server) которые теперь работают на FC, а так же патчи для ядра FC.
Все предыдущие версии Win4Lin не работают в FC, поэтому рекомендуется
сделать обновление.

>>> Подробности

McMCC
()

Вышел долгожданный релиз Fedora Project 1

Группа Red Hat

Вышел наконец релиз Fedora Project 1, дату выхода которого
отложили на пару дней, слишком много надо было решить
нюансов связанных с именем RedHat и переправить на Fedora, плюс
некоторые критические исправления, и так качаем, смотрим и
обсуждаем....

Полную информацию о проекте и направлениях развития можно получить
на http://fedora.redhat.com/

>>> Подробности

McMCC
()

Подключение модемов ZyXEL серии Omni 56K по шине USB в ОС Linux.

Группа Документация

Данная статья рассказывает о том, как можно подключить модемы
серии ZyXEL Omni 56K снабженных USB интерфейсом

>>> Подробности

McMCC
()

RSS подписка на новые темы